GCX 2025 NATIONAL FARMERS DAY SPEECH - REGIONAL

Date: 8th Dec, 2025

GCX 2025 NATIONAL FARMERS DAY SPEECH - REGIONAL image


Honourable Regional Minister, invited guests, esteemed farmers, ladies, and gentlemen.

I am delighted to be part of this year's Farmers' Day celebration, themed "Eat Ghana, Grow Ghana, Secure the Future." This occasion is a testament to the hard work and dedication of Ghanaian farmers, who are the backbone of our economy.

As the representative of the Ghana Commodity Exchange (GCX), I would like to highlight the critical role that structured markets play in ensuring that farmers receive fair prices for their produce. GCX provides a platform for buyers and sellers to trade in a secure and transparent environment, reducing the risks associated with agricultural trade.

However, we are aware of the challenges facing the sector, including post-harvest losses, limited access to finance, and the influx of imported goods that can undercut local produce. To address these issues, we propose the development of structured value chains, where farmers can access inputs, finance, and markets in a coordinated manner.

Initiatives like the Ghana Horticulture Expo 2025 demonstrate the government's commitment to agricultural transformation. We believe that public-private partnerships can drive innovation and investment in the sector, creating opportunities for farmers to increase their productivity and incomes.

To make Farmers' Day a turning point, we need to focus on building a structured system that attracts investment and provides farmers with the tools they need to succeed. This includes access to quality seeds, fertilizers, and equipment, as well as training and support to improve productivity and competitiveness.

At GCX, we are committed to supporting farmers and traders by providing a platform for price discovery, risk management, and market access. We believe that by working together, we can build a more resilient and prosperous agricultural sector that benefits all Ghanaians.

Let us work towards a future where agriculture is a thriving sector that attracts investment, creates jobs, and ensures food security for all. Thank you.
